Cobb County's clay composition is both a blessing and a challenge. That dense soil base gives your property stability, but it doesn't drain naturally, which means standing water and compaction issues hit harder on commercial properties where foot and vehicle traffic is constant. Artificial turf actually thrives in these conditions because we install a proper base layer that manages moisture while the turf itself stays green and even. East Cobb's neighborhoods tend toward larger, established lots with mature trees, which creates pockets of shade that real grass can't fill in consistently. Synthetic turf performs uniformly whether your property sits in full sun or dappled shade. Artificial turf eliminates mowing, fertilizer, pest control, and irrigation costs. For a typical East Cobb commercial lot, that's thousands of dollars per year. You'll do occasional rinsing and minor debris cleanup—that's it. Most properties break even on installation within 3–4 years through maintenance savings alone.
